Milliwatt generator heat source. Progress report, July-December 1981 (open access)

Milliwatt generator heat source. Progress report, July-December 1981

As part of the Milliwatt Generator (MWG) Program, a second series of pressure burst capsules welded offsite was tested; the resulting data indicate that the welds are very similar to those in the first series of capsules. Sufficient hardware was fabricated to meet all scheduled commitments. To provide a unit for feasibility testing, a heat source clad with Hastelloy C was reclad with Inconel 600. Forming development tests on Inconel 600 were conducted with favorable results. A QAS-3 survey was conducted and a satisfactory rating was received. Lot 11 qualification began on T-111 materials. The production period ended with an overall process yield of 99.6%, and a dollar percent defective rate of 0.60%.

Imaging system for obtaining space- and time-resolved plasma images on TMX (open access)

Imaging system for obtaining space- and time-resolved plasma images on TMX

A Reticon 50 x 50 photodiode array camera has been placed on Livermore's Tandem Mirror Experiment to view a 56-cm diameter plasma source of visible, vacuum-ultraviolet, and x-ray photons. The compact camera views the source through a pinhole, filters, a fiber optic coupler, a microchannel plate intensifier (MCPI), and a reducer. The images are digitized (at 3.3 MHz) and stored in a large, high-speed memory that has a capacity of 45 images. A local LSI-11 microprocessor provides immediate processing and display of the data. The data are also stored on floppy disks that can be further processed on the large Livermore Computer System. The temporal resolution is limited by the fastest MCPI gate. The number of images recorded is determined by the read-out time of the Reticon camera (minimum 0.9 msec). The spatial resolution of approximately 1.4 cm is fixed by the geometry and the pinhole of 0.025 cm. Typical high-quality color representation of some plasma images are included.

Present capabilities and new developments in antenna modeling with the numerical electromagnetics code NEC (open access)

Present capabilities and new developments in antenna modeling with the numerical electromagnetics code NEC

Computer modeling of antennas, since its start in the late 1960's, has become a powerful and widely used tool for antenna design. Computer codes have been developed based on the Method-of-Moments, Geometrical Theory of Diffraction, or integration of Maxwell's equations. Of such tools, the Numerical Electromagnetics Code-Method of Moments (NEC) has become one of the most widely used codes for modeling resonant sized antennas. There are several reasons for this including the systematic updating and extension of its capabilities, extensive user-oriented documentation and accessibility of its developers for user assistance. The result is that there are estimated to be several hundred users of various versions of NEC world wide. 23 refs., 10 figs.

Laboratory procedures used in the hot corrosion project (open access)

Laboratory procedures used in the hot corrosion project

The objective of the Hot Corrosion Project in the LLNL Metals and Ceramics Division is to study the physical and chemical mechanisms of corrosion of nickel, iron, and some of their alloys when these metals are subjected to oxidizing or sulfidizing environments at temperatures between 850 and 950/sup 0/C. To obtain meaningful data in this study, we must rigidly control many parameters. Parameters are discussed and the methods chosen to control them in this laboratory. Some of the mechanics and manipulative procedures that are specifically related to data access and repeatability are covered. The method of recording and processing the data from each experiment using an LS-11 minicomputer are described. The analytical procedures used to evaluate the specimens after the corrosion tests are enumerated and discussed.

Electromagnetic velocity gauge: use of multiple gauges, time response, and flow perturbations (open access)

Electromagnetic velocity gauge: use of multiple gauges, time response, and flow perturbations

We have developed an in-situ electromagnetic velocity (EMV) gauge system for use in multiple-gauge studies of initiating and detonating explosives. We have also investigated the risetime of the gauge and the manner in which it perturbs a reactive flow. We report on the special precautions that are necessary in multiple gauge experiments to reduce lead spreading, simplify target fabrication problems and minimize cross talk through the conducting explosive. Agreement between measured stress records and calculations from multiple velocity gauge data give us confidence that our velocity gauges are recording properly. We have used laser velocity interferometry to measure the gauge risetime in polymethyl methacrylate (PMMA). To resolve the difference in the two methods, we have examined hydrodynamic and material rate effects. In addition, we considered the effects of shock tilt, electronic response and magntic diffusion on the gauge's response time.

Two-dimensional gas flow in an electrode assembly (open access)

Two-dimensional gas flow in an electrode assembly

The interface between a source of positive or negative ions and a multichannel MEQALAC accelerator will be the Low-Energy Beam Transport (LEBT) consisting of a lattice of quadrupole focusing electrodes transporting the beam while the gas pressure is reduced from the high-pressure ion source to the low-pressure accelerator. Gas emitted from the ion source will flow through the LEBT electrode lattice to a pumping volume. It is necessary to analyze the two-dimensional gas flow to ascertain the gas densities throughout the LEBT and to design the system so that only a small fraction of the ion beam is lost by gas collisions. The analysis uses the fact that the gas-flow rate is proportional to the density gradient if the mean free path of the low-pressure gas is greater than the inter-electrode spacing. Consequently the mathematics developed for conductivity of heat or electric current can be used. The practical result of this analysis is to determine the maximum width of the LEBT so that the beam loss by gas collisions is tolerable. The maximum width is a function of beam density, gas efficiency, and electrode spacing. The beam current per unit length of module will be somewhat greater than 75 mA/cm. …

Qualitative comparisons of fusion reactor materials for waste handling and disposal (open access)

Qualitative comparisons of fusion reactor materials for waste handling and disposal

The activation of five structural materials and seven coolant/breeder/multiplier materials in a common reference neutron environment was calculated with the FORIG activation code. The reference environment was the neutron flux and spectrum at the first wall of the mirror advanced reactor study (MARS) reactor. Qualitative comparison of these activated materials were made with respect to worker protection requirements for gamma radiation in handling the materials and with respect to their classifications for near-surface disposal of radioactive waste.

Development of Alcohol-Based Synthetic Transportation Fuels From Coal-Derived Synthesis Gases. First Quarterly Progress Report, September 14-December 31, 1979 (open access)

Development of Alcohol-Based Synthetic Transportation Fuels From Coal-Derived Synthesis Gases. First Quarterly Progress Report, September 14-December 31, 1979

Chem Systems is carrying out an experimental program for the conversion of coal-derived synthesis gases to a mixture of C/sub 1/-C/sub 4/ alcohols. The objectives of this contract are to: (1) develop a catalyst and reactor system for producing a mixture of C/sub 1/-C/sub 4/ alcohols, which we call Alkanol fuel, to be used as a synthetic transportation fuel and (2) assess the technical and economic feasibility of scaling the process concept to a commercial-scale application. Some of the accomplishments made this quarter were: (1) a small (75cc) fixed-bed, plug-flow, vapor phase reaction system was set up and operated utilizing catalyst bed dilution with inert media to help limit the large exotherm associated with the synthesis gas conversion reactions; (2) a total of fifteen (15) catalysts containing varying amounts of Cu, Co, Zn, Cr and K were prepared and seven of these catalysts were tested; (3) we have identified at least one promising catalyst composition which has resulted in a 30% conversion of carbon monoxide per pass (synthesis gas had a 3.5 H/sub 2//CO ratio) with a carbon selectivity to alcohols of about 80%.
